## FlagForge Build Provenance

All FlagForge rollout-framework releases are built on sealed runners and signed before publication. Plugin authors must verify the signature and compare the manifest digest before linking against a release. Unsigned artifacts are never supported and will be rejected at load time. Each verified release page lists its provenance token directly below.

trace token, fafog-kageg: htk4_98e6

TICKET VLD-482: Signature check failing on validator plugin load. Since Tuesday, the Quillbrook validator host rejects every third-party plugin with SIG_MISMATCH. Root cause: the plugin registry rotated its manifest key but the loader still pins the old fingerprint. Fix: update the pinned fingerprint in loader config, redeploy, re-run the conformance suite. Don't touch the sandbox flags. You'll need the current key to re-sign the test plugins locally. The active signing key is as follows.

release key, hadug-kawef: bky13_mPGeFZeR1GZ1G

## Runbook: Canary Gating Rules

For the weekly sync: Driftgate canaries promote automatically only when error rate stays under 0.5% and p95 latency within 10% of baseline for 30 minutes. Any manual override must be logged in the gating table with a reason. Rollbacks reset the observation window. Gate decisions and override history are stored in the deploy-metrics database; query it using the connection string below.

primary connection of hadup-kajeg = clickhouse://rusath_svc:lTa6pgZ@db-a477.plorvaforge.corp:5432/oliox